Innocent_Guy wrote: »What will it flag then?
My inconsistancies are time at address & employer
Mate you know the answers to this! We both done the N Hunter thread at the same time you nuggat lol.......
They will record nothing, if it tallies up with your last application. It would only refer it if (and only if) the data supplied (by you) was different each time you made an application!
Example:
1. I apply to barclays and say I live at 12 anyplace and have done for 10 years.
2 I then apply to abbey and say I live at 168 high street and have done for 10 years.
This would show an obvious lie (the length of residency) thus a marker will be added and both lenders would be informed.
Example 2:
1. You apply for a credit product and give one address
2. You then apply elsewhere and give the same details
3. You then apply elsewhere and change the address slightly
4. You then apply elsewhere and use the address in case 3
This would be fine, because although there is a change between addresses - the actual data is not reporting a lie (i.e. how can you be at two addresses for 10 years each at the same time!)...
Its hard to explain in writing mate! lol
As for employer details, again unless you make a blatant lie about dates etc then it will not get flagged cos people do guess! Like me, been doing this for 5+ years so I always say 5 years - this must be wrong cos I said 5 years last year and still do to this day - easy to remember!
